WebOct 15, 2024 · States contracted with a total of 282 Medicaid MCOs as of July 2024. MCOs represent a mix of private for-profit, private non-profit, and government plans. As of July 2024, a total of 16 firms operated Medicaid MCOs in two or more states ,6 and these firms accounted for 63% of enrollment in 2024 . Of the 16 parent firms, seven are publicly …

WebPACE. Program of All-Inclusive Care for the Elderly (PACE) is a Medicare and Medicaid program that helps people meet their health care needs in the community instead of going to a nursing home or other care facility.
